In terms of supporting biodiversity, hedges play an indispensable role. They act as important habitats and corridors for wildlife, providing shelter, food sources, and safe passage across landscapes. The thick foliage serves as a nesting site for all sorts of birds, whilst small mammals and insects establish dwellings at the hedge's roots. Different species feast on the fruits, flowers, and the abundant insects provided by the hedge. Through their fragmentation of the landscape, hedges aid in the creation of diverse microclimates, offering extra niches for different species. Furthermore, they provide a safe haven from extreme weather conditions and predators. Thus, the conservation and appropriate management of our hedges are not merely advantageous but crucial for supporting local wildlife.

Do You Cut Top or Side of Hedge First?

When trimming a hedge, it's usually best to start with the sides and then trim the top last.

  1. Sides: Begin your trimming at the hedge's base, gradually moving upwards to form a slight "batter" or slope on either side. By ensuring the base is wider than the top, sunlight can filter down to the lower branches, thereby maintaining the hedge's health and thickness all the way down.
  2. Top: The trimming of the top of the hedge can follow after you've taken care of the sides. This is typically the most challenging part of the process, especially for tall hedges. A strong and sturdy step ladder should be used, and efforts made to maintain even cuts for a top that is level and flat.

In case of a seriously overgrown hedge, you might need to undertake the trimming task across several seasons, particularly if over a third of the entire hedge needs to be pruned. Taking such a gradual approach could prevent your plants from becoming overly stressed. Don't forget the importance of cleaning up post-trimming to curb disease spread and maintain a tidy garden.

Bird's Nests in Hedges

Bird's Nests Coulsdon

An issue that a lot of householders in Coulsdon may not automatically think about when clipping their hedge is birds nesting in them and what the current legislation is with regards to this. Throughout the nesting bird breeding season, which is between March and August, the Royal Society for the Protection of Birds (RSPB) recommends that any extensive trimming back of hedges and trees shouldn't occur. The issue is that these are the months during which most home owners will be aiming to cut their hedges and do all of their routine garden maintenance. It has been a punishable offence "to intentionally damage, destroy or take the nest of any wild bird while it is in use or being built", since the introduction of the Wildlife and Countryside Act (1981). Consequently, to help to preserve our irreplaceable wildlife, make sure you check your hedges for bird's nests prior to cutting them back.

Hedge Planting

Planting hedges is an excellent method to enhance privacy and beauty in your garden. A row of bushes or shrubs forms a natural barrier that blocks noise, wind, and unwelcome views. Additionally, hedges offer a habitat for wildlife, drawing birds and beneficial insects to your garden. Popular hedge options include privet, boxwood, and laurel, which are all easy to grow and maintain.

Hedge Planting Coulsdon

Selecting the right spot and preparing the soil properly is important when planting a hedge. Make sure the area gets enough sunlight and has proper drainage. Dig a trench wide and deep enough to fit the roots of your plants. Space the plants evenly to give them room to grow and fill out. Water the plants thoroughly after planting and maintain moist soil until they are established.

Regular maintenance is vital to ensure your hedge remains healthy and attractive. Trim the hedge regularly to foster dense growth and maintain the desired shape. Mulch around the base of the plants to conserve moisture and suppress weeds. With some care and attention, your hedge will thrive and become a beautiful, functional element of your garden.

Privet Hedges Coulsdon

Across Coulsdon, the lush leaves and well-defined lines of privet hedges make them a popular feature in many gardens. Frequently overlooked, these modest bushes provide numerous advantages, rendering them a favoured option among both landscape designers and property owners. Here we look at just a handful of the many benefits associated with privet hedges:

Privet Hedges Coulsdon
  1. Fast-Growing: Should you be in search of a fast solution for your privacy, these hedges make a great option. Their speedy growth allows for the creation of a significant barrier in a relatively brief period.
  2. Wildlife Habitat: While not known for attracting a wide variety of wildlife, privet hedges offer nesting places for wild birds. They also provide a good food source - black berries - but be aware, these are mildly poisonous to humans and should not be consumed.
  3. Pollution Tolerance: Exhibiting a surprising tolerance for air pollution, privet hedges are aptly suited for use in gardens in built-up areas.
  4. Formal or Informal Styles: Privet hedges can be trimmed into both formal, geometric shapes or a more relaxed, informal style, depending on the variety and pruning regime.
  5. Noise Supression: When situated in close proximity to busy roads in Coulsdon, or areas that experience significant noise, gardens benefit from the compact foliage's role as a natural sound barrier.
  6. Cost-Effective Solution: Privet hedges are seen as a more cost-efficient option relative to fences and other screening techniques. The small amount of materials required and the low maintenance needed position them as an economically sound alternative.
  7. Screening and Privacy: The visual barrier that's created by the dense foliage of a well-maintained privet hedge provides privacy from passers-by and neighbours. Unattractive areas of the garden can also be effectively screened.
  8. Minimal Maintenance: A primary advantage of privet hedges is their low-maintenance nature. They're relatively tolerant of different soil conditions and don't need much pruning to keep them looking tidy and neat.

Planting and Caring for Your Privet Hedge

With a little planning, you can cultivate a beautiful privet hedge. Planting and maintaining it is a hassle-free task:

  1. Watering: To ensure the roots get properly established, water frequently, especially during the first year after planting. Privet hedges are relatively drought-tolerant once they are established.
  2. Choosing the Right Location: Drainage is key! Choose a sunny or partially shaded spot with well-draining soil for optimal plant growth.
  3. Spacing: To achieve a dense hedge, plant spacing should correspond to the intended mature size. Normally, this means planting individual shrubs 40-60cm (16-24in) apart.
  4. Planting Time: When establishing a privet hedge, choose spring or autumn for planting. This ensures the soil is damp but not waterlogged.
  5. Pruning: For a hedge that maintains its desired size and shape, regular pruning is vital. The most effective window for pruning falls in late spring or early summertime.
  6. Feeding: Applying a balanced fertiliser in spring can encourage healthy growth, although this isn't strictly necessary.
